Art insurance is a specialized type of insurance coverage designed to protect valuable works of art from damage, theft, and other unforeseen events. For professionals in the art world – including artists, collectors, galleries, museums, and dealers – investing in the right insurance coverage can mean the difference between financial ruin and peace of mind.
One of the main reasons why art professionals need insurance is the high value associated with their work. Unlike many other types of assets, art pieces can be worth millions of dollars, making them prime targets for theft and fraud. Without proper insurance coverage, artists and other professionals risk losing everything they have worked so hard to create.
Additionally, art professionals often face unique risks that are not covered by standard insurance policies. For example, damage to an art piece during transportation or while on display at an exhibition may not be covered by a general liability policy. With specialized art insurance coverage, professionals can protect their work against these specific risks and ensure that they are fully protected in any scenario.
There are several types of art insurance solutions available for professionals, each tailored to meet the specific needs of this niche market. One common type of coverage is fine art insurance, which provides protection for individual pieces or collections against damage, theft, and other risks. This type of coverage is ideal for artists, collectors, and galleries who own valuable art pieces that need to be protected.
Another important type of art insurance for professionals is exhibition insurance. This coverage is designed to protect art pieces while they are on display at a gallery, museum, or other venue. In the event of damage, theft, or other covered events, exhibition insurance can provide financial compensation to cover the cost of repairs or replacements.
In addition to these specific types of coverage, art professionals can also benefit from comprehensive art insurance packages that combine multiple types of coverage into one policy. These packages are often tailored to meet the unique needs of individual professionals, providing a customized solution that offers peace of mind and financial protection.
